How much does it cost to get your teeth permanently whitened?

The average cost of in-office teeth whitening is $650, although it can climb to $1,000 or more, depending on the type of product used and how much your dentist charges.

How much does a professional whitening cost?

Professional Teeth Whitening Costs. Professional teeth whitening products are more expensive than at-home treatments. The average price for in-office whitening ranges from $450 to $1,000 per treatment.

  • How is professional teeth whitening done?

    Before starting,the dentist will make a record of the current shade of your teeth.

  • Your teeth would then be polished with pumice,a grainy material used to remove any plaque on the surface.
  • Your mouth will be isolated with gauze to keep your teeth dry.

  • What happens when you bleach your teeth?

    The bleach opens the pores (or tubules) in your tooth enamel so that it can remove stains. This stimulates the nerves, which can be painful, particularly if you exceed the time noted on the packaging or if you bleach too often. It takes a few days for your saliva to remineralize your teeth and make the pain go away.
